Apparatus and process for making acid-doped proton exchange membranes

A continuous automated process and production line for preparing an acid doped polybenzimidazole, PBI, polymer membrane film for use in a fuel cell, the process having a washing stage, a drying procedure, and a doping stage.

Self-healing capacitor and methods of production thereof

A self-healing capacitor comprises a first electrode, a second electrode, and a dielectric layer disposed between said first and second electrodes and having first surface faced the first electrode and second surface faced the second electrode. At least one of the electrodes can include metal foam. The dielectric layer can have electrically conductive channels that each has an exit point located on the first surface of the dielectric layer and another exit point located on the second surface of the dielectric layer. The electrodes can include local contact breakers each of which is located within the electrode at an interface between the dielectric layer and the electrode and opposite at least one exit point of each electrically conductive channel in the dielectric layer. The local contact breakers can prevent electric current through the conductive channels in dielectric layer.

Acid resistant PBI membrane for pervaporation dehydration of acidic solvents

A pervaporation membrane may be an acid-resistant polybenzidimazole (PBI) membrane. The acid-resistant PBI membrane may be a PBI membrane chemically modified by a process selected from the group consisting of sulfonation, phosphonation, cross-linking, N-substitution, and/or combinations thereof. The membrane may be thermally stabilized. A method for the dehydration of an acid material may include the steps of: contacting an acidic aqueous solution with a membrane of an acid-resistant polybenzidimazole; taking away a permeate stream rich in water; and taking away a concentrate steam rich in the acid material. The acidic aqueous solution may be acetic acid.
